4 of 7 | Pickup and Delivery Service

If you’re juggling work, family, or just a packed schedule, a laundry service that comes to you can save you valuable time and effort. So before signing up, here’s what you need to know to find a reliable and convenient laundry service that fits your needs.

Do They Offer Free Pickup and Delivery Service?

One of the first things to check is whether Pickup and Delivery Service is included in the price or if there’s an additional fee.

  • Some laundry services offer free Pickup and Delivery Service as part of their standard package.
  • Others charge a fee based on your location—this is common if you live outside their main service area.
  • Subscription-based services may bundle free Pickup and Delivery Service into their pricing for weekly or bi-weekly customers.

If convenience is your priority, choose a local laundry service that offers hassle-free scheduling and no hidden fees for pickup and delivery.

How Easy Is It to Schedule a Pickup?

A great Wash and Fold Laundry Service should make scheduling a Pickup and Delivery Service as easy as possible. Look for:

  • Online booking options – Can you schedule a pickup through their website or app?
  • Flexible scheduling – Do they offer same-day pickups, next-day returns, or scheduled weekly pickups?
  • Multiple contact methods – Can you book a pickup via phone, email, or text?

The best services allow customers to set their preferred pickup frequency, whether it’s on-demand, weekly, or bi-weekly.

Do They Have a Reliable Delivery Process?

  • Tracking and Notifications: Do they send text or email updates when your laundry is picked up and delivered?
  • Secure Delivery: If you’re not home, can they leave your clean laundry in a secure spot or with a doorman?
  • Consistent Drivers and Routes: Are pickups and deliveries handled by inhouse staff or third-party couriers?

Is There a Minimum Order Requirement?

Some Wash and Fold Laundry Services have a minimum weight or price requirement for pickup and delivery orders.

  • Common minimums range from 10 to 15 pounds of laundry per order.
  • Flat-rate options for small loads may be available, but often cost more.
  • If you have light loads, check if they charge a small-load fee before scheduling.

5 of 7 | How Do They Handle Lost or Damaged Items?

A reliable Wash and Fold Laundry Service should have clear policies in place for handling lost or damaged items, so you’re not left frustrated and out of pocket. Before signing up, here’s what you need to know about how they track, recover, and compensate for lost or ruined laundry.

Do They Have a Tracking System to Prevent Lost Laundry?

The best way to avoid lost clothing is to ensure the laundry service has a tracking system in place. Some laundromats still rely on handwritten tags, while others use digital tracking for each customer’s laundry bag.

  • Do they label your laundry bag with a unique tag or barcode?
  • Do they wash each customer’s laundry separately, or is it mixed?
  • Is there a system in place to prevent mix-ups between customers?

What Happens If an Item Goes Missing?

Even with the best tracking systems, mistakes happen. Before signing up, ask the service how they handle missing items.

  • Do they actively look for lost items? 
  • Do they offer compensation? 
  • What is their lost item claim process?

What If Your Clothes Come Back Damaged?

A great Wash and Fold Laundry Service should use proper detergents, wash cycles, and drying temperatures to prevent damage. However, accidents like shrinkage, fading, or tearing can still happen.

  • Do they check clothing labels and follow care instructions? 
  • Do they offer refunds or replacements for damaged clothing? 
  • Are delicate items washed separately?

Some services won’t take responsibility for damage to items without care labels, so always check their policy before dropping off laundry.

6 of 7 | Special Care for Delicate Items (Linen, Suede, Leather, and More)

Woman with long hair wearing a brown leather jacket stands in front of a reflective glass building, looking to the side.

If your wardrobe includes linen shirts, suede jackets, leather pants, or silk blouses and dresses, you need a laundry service that understands how to properly clean, dry, and care for fragile items. Before signing up, make sure the service you choose offers special care for delicate fabrics and won’t just toss your premium garments into a high-heat industrial washer with everything else.

Does the Laundry Service Offer Hand Washing or Gentle Cleaning?

Some fabrics require extra care and should never be machine washed in hot water or thrown into a dryer. A professional Wash and Fold Laundry Service should have the right cleaning methods for delicate items such as:

  • Linen
  • Suede and Leather
  • Silk and Wool
  • Beaded, Embroidered, or Lace Items

How Do They Handle Air Drying vs. Machine Drying?

One of the biggest mistakes a laundry service can make is tossing delicate items into a high-heat dryer. A quality service should offer:

  • Air drying or hang drying options for linen, wool, and lace.
  • Low-heat drying settings for items that can’t handle excessive heat.
  • Flat drying for sweaters and knitwear to prevent stretching.

Can You Provide Special Instructions for Delicate Clothing?

A professional Wash and Fold Laundry Service should allow customers to request custom care instructions for fragile garments.

  • Do they follow garment care labels? 
  • Can you request cold water washing or hand washing? 
  • Are they willing to separate delicate items from regular laundry?

If a laundry service doesn’t accommodate special requests, they may not be the right choice for your delicate items.
